Extended Data Fig. 2: CLL biological pathways affected by candidate driver genes.
From: Molecular map of chronic lymphocytic leukemia and its impact on outcome

a. Schema of CLL pathways containing previously identified (black) and novel (magenta) putative driver genes (see Supplementary Table 6). Novel drivers cluster in central processes driving CLL (for example, DNA damage, chromatin modification, RNA processing)1,2, but also highlight new pathways not previously implicated by driver genes (for example, cytoskeleton and extracellular matrix, proteostasis, metabolism). Asterisks - mutated genes discovered by CLUMPs. b. Stacked barplot ranked by the number of candidate driver genes per CLL pathway. Magenta bars show the number of newly identified drivers in each pathway.
